Annotation: The article explores the integration of digital technologies into the assessment of eyebrow morphology and the planning of their correction as a new stage in the development of aesthetic medicine. The aim of the study is to examine the impact of advanced technologies on the eyebrow correction process, taking into account facial morphology, which is understood as the analysis of facial shape, proportions, and symmetry in order to create a personalized image. The study employed general scientific methods of cognition: analysis, synthesis, comparison, modeling, systematization, and generalization. The findings indicate that the modern approach to eyebrow shaping is based on a combination of anatomical knowledge, age-related morphological features, innovative digital modeling, and standardized aesthetic parameters. The interdisciplinary nature of eyebrow morphology is emphasized, as it integrates anatomical, aesthetic, and anthropometric knowledge to enable precise analysis and correction of eyebrow shape while considering individual patient characteristics such as age, gender, ethnicity, and facial structure. It is noted that effective eyebrow shaping cannot be achieved without taking into account the facial morphotype and deep anatomical changes, especially in older patients. The study shows that digital technologies are actively being implemented in the field of eyebrow modeling and correction, with the most significant being: artificial intelligence (AI); augmented and virtual reality (AR/VR); 3D printing; 3D photogrammetry; CAD/CAM technologies. AI provides a personalized approach to analysis and modeling, while AR/VR allows real-time testing and visualization of different shape options. 3D printing is used for the creation of customized stencils or models, and 3D photogrammetry enables the acquisition of highly accurate facial parameters. CAD/CAM technologies ensure symmetry in both aesthetic and surgical procedures. The prospects for further development in this field are outlined: implementation of AI-based mobile applications for instant visualization of results; development of biometric models that consider age-related changes; AR technologies for dynamic eyebrow shape fitting; application of 3D scanners to monitor intervention effectiveness; and the use of virtual simulations as a communication tool between specialists and patients. The practical value of the study lies in the implementation of a personalized digital approach to eyebrow correction planning based on scientifically grounded morphological parameters.

Annotation: Amid accelerating global digitalization of business processes, the integration of ERP systems into supply chain management has become a key factor in determining the competitiveness of modern enterprises. The aim of this article is to provide a multifaceted analysis of the transformational impact of enterprise resource planning (ERP) platforms on logistics operations, with a focus on identifying and describing mechanisms that enhance the efficiency of material flows. Ongoing academic debates reveal significant contradictions regarding the optimal level of ERP system customization, the role of the human factor in implementation, and the potential for integration with Industry 4.0 technologies. Based on a structured review of relevant publications, it is observed that the comprehensive integration of ERP platforms into supply chain architecture leads not only to quantitative improvements in operational performance—such as inventory reduction and enhanced forecasting accuracy—but also to a qualitative transformation of managerial paradigms. In this context, the author outlines a perspective on the development of workforce competencies within the digital ecosystem. Annotation: This paper studies the implementation of artificial intelligence (AI) in creating personalized nail services. The promotion presents an analysis of contemporary technologies-namely, machine learning and natural language processing in the development of an exclusive pattern of nail designs that will be based on the personal preferences of a particular client. An account is given of how data can be collected through social networks and survey platforms, the following analysis of which supports the establishment of a custom solution for the clientele. An overview of existing technological platforms in the beauty industry used to achieve similar goals is presented with an eye to prospects for this sector’s development, thereby including, among other things, 3D printing and augmented reality technologies. The paper also contains the major barriers of the proposed innovations' integration into practice. The study brings out the potential application of AI as a tool to improve service quality and customer satisfaction in the beauty sector.
